Abstract
Perinatal nurses in the hospital setting have prolonged contact with new mothers and are in a vital position to provide postpartum depression patient education. This study describes the development and implementation of an education intervention that led to nurses' increased knowledge and provision of postpartum depression patient education. The framework can be utilized by nursing professional development practitioners to develop staff education programs to improve patient education in various clinical settings.Entities:
